Doorly & Friends: Young'Uns EP 1

Various Artists

Reptile Dysfunction
RD004 | 2017-07-14  
One of my main reasons for setting up Reptile Dysfunction was to shine the light on some of the amazing fresh young that I meet on the road on my travels around the world, and start to build a little crew from some of these equally amazing people to be part of my label family. I'm fully confident that you will be hearing a lot more from all the guys featured on this EP, not least on Reptile Dysfunction where I'm currently working on tracks and/or helping them put together their first full EPs. You've already met Tan Dem, Trooko & El Prevost, (LOTS more to come from all of those cats!). But in the meantime, I wanted to use this release as an opportunity to introduce you to these guys with a track from each of them to give you a little taster. On this EP you will find 2 collaborations involving my fair hand and a bunch of solo tracks from the other guys. Here's a bit of info about all of them:

Josh Newsham I got to know properly when he was working as an artist liaison at a gig I was playing at Sankeys in Manchester. He's also been working summers in Ibiza for yonkers. He has been sending me demos for a while and it's been really nice to hear him getting better and better. I really liked the Idea he had for Trip to Medina so I decided to give it a little massage with my sausage fingers work on the track together and here you have it. You may recognize it as I've been playing it in most sets for the last 6 months.

Colour Castle aka Christian & Casper are from Sydney Australia and they've been sending me demos for a while. We played a bonkers show together in Byron bay and got on like brothers separated at birth, so we decided to work on a couple of collabs together. This track, "Stay Hungry", I thought was a perfect fit for Reptile Dysfunction - nice, warm, funky, nonsensical house music! Enjoy!

Blantyre Aka Trev is a fellow Ibiza Local, he's lived on the island for years and he's a lovely, lovely man. He gave me this track on a usb stick of demos at a BBQ a while ago and I have been playing it ever since, with plenty more where that came from!

Charlie Rope is one of my team of young residents for my Ibiza Based "Doorly & Friends" parties on the Island. He's been doing the summer seasons for years, he's a wicked DJ and is always last man standing at a session, so it was great to start hearing his productions getting cracking this winter. The boy has been on fire and we will be releasing his first full EP on Reptile Dysfunction in autumn, but here's a teaser of his bouncy, sample based vibes.

Mobula aka Rory Lyons is the brand new alias for a long time collaborator and friend of mine. He actually gave me my first break in Ibiza 12 years ago when he was playing for Ibiza Rocks as Cassette Jam, He suggested me and I got the gig that eventually led to me living here all year round, so it's nice to be able to return the favour! We have a 2 track collab EP coming out together this summer but here's a solo track from Mobula for now.

And last but by no means least we have the boy Griff. He's quite the character, any Ibiza summer season regulars will be more than familiar with his work. He's another one of my team of awesome selectors I bring in to set the tone at my Doorly & Friends parties, and one of the most fun people to be around at an afterparty on the planet! He's been at home away from temptation in Stirling all winter and its lovely to see his productions getting better and better! Griff will feature a track on the first Reptile Dysfunction Vinyl Disco Edits release in august. This track, "Pawn the Monkey" is cheeky and fun and what really tops it off is this video he made of his uncle dancing to it around the landmarks of Stirling!

-Doorly
